python3.10安装wxpython
时间: 2023-05-31 21:19:30 浏览: 583
### 回答1:
要安装Python 3.10的wxPython,可以按照以下步骤进行操作:
1. 首先,确保你已经安装了Python 3.10版本。如果没有安装,可以从官网下载并安装。
2. 接下来,需要安装wxPython的依赖库。在Windows系统上,可以使用以下命令安装:
```
pip install -U pip setuptools
pip install -U -f https://extras.wxpython.org/wxPython4/extras/win64pip/ wxPython
```
在Linux系统上,可以使用以下命令安装:
```
pip install -U pip setuptools
pip install -U -f https://extras.wxpython.org/wxPython4/extras/linux/gtk3/ubuntu-20.04 wxPython
```
3. 安装完成后,可以在Python中导入wx模块进行测试。例如:
```
import wx
app = wx.App()
frame = wx.Frame(None, title="Hello World")
frame.Show()
app.MainLoop()
```
运行以上代码,如果能够正常显示一个窗口,则说明wxPython已经成功安装。
### 回答2:
Python3.10是最新版本的Python,而wxPython是Python下一款用于GUI开发的库。目前,大多数版本的wxPython都可以通过pip安装,而Python3.10对于wxPython的安装则有些特殊。
下面是Python3.10安装wxPython的步骤:
步骤一:下载wxPython源码包
首先你需要下载wxPython源码包。你可以通过wxPython官网(https://www.wxpython.org/pages/downloads/)下载到最新的wxPython源码包。选择版本后,从对应的操作系统和Python版本的下载链接中下载。
步骤二:安装编译工具
在编译wxPython之前,你需要安装一些必要的编译工具。如果你是Linux系统,可以通过以下命令安装:
sudo apt-get update
sudo apt-get install build-essential
sudo apt-get install libgtk-3-dev libwebkit2gtk-4.0-dev libssl-dev libcurl4-openssl-dev
步骤三:解压wxPython源码包并进入目录
将wxPython源码包解压并进入解压后的目录。
步骤四:在Python虚拟环境中编译wxPython
如果你的Python环境中已经有wxPython的旧版,建议先将其删除。接下来,在Python虚拟环境中运行以下步骤:
python -m venv wxpython
source wxpython/bin/activate
cd wxPython-src-dir
python build.py build
在这里,`wxPython-src-dir`是你解压wxPython源码包的目录。以上步骤将编译wxPython并将其安装到Python虚拟环境中。
步骤五:测试wxPython是否安装成功
安装完成后,你需要测试wxPython是否安装成功。在Python虚拟环境中运行以下命令:
python -c "import wx; wx.App(); wx.MessageBox('wxPython installed successfully', 'Success', wx.OK|wx.ICON_INFORMATION)"
如果没有出现任何错误,表示wxPython已经成功安装。至此,Python3.10安装wxPython的步骤就结束了。
### 回答3:
Python 3.10是较新的Python版本,而wxPython是一种Python GUI工具包,它提供了Python程序的界面设计、交互和兼容性。在学习Python GUI编程时,wxPython是一种非常方便的工具。在本文中,我们将讨论如何在Python 3.10中安装wxPython。
wxPython可以通过pip或源码安装。pip是一个用于Python的包管理器,它可以为Python安装、升级和删除软件包。源码安装,即从官方网站下载wxPython源码并编译安装程序包。
一、pip安装wxPython
在Python 3.10中,安装wxPython3.1.5:打开终端或命令行,使用以下命令安装wxPython3.1.5。
```python
pip install -U wxPython
```
这个命令将在Python中安装wxPython。
二、源码安装wxPython
浏览到wxPython官网 https://wxpython.org/pages/downloads/index.html,下载对应版本的wxPython源代码,并在本地解压。
然后在终端或命令行中使用以下命令进入wxPython解压目录:
```python
cd wxPython-x.x.x.x
```
x.x.x.x代表您所下载的版本号。接下来,在终端或命令行中使用以下命令开始编译wxPython:
```python
python setup.py build_ext --inplace
```
请注意,这可能需要一些时间才能完成。
最后,使用以下命令在Python中安装新编译的wxPython程序包:
```python
python setup.py install
```
至此,wxPython已经成功安装在Python中。您现在可以开始享受Python GUI编程的乐趣了。
阅读全文